Yes - a Sonos Sub just needs a power connection. Once it’s plugged into mains power, it should start flashing a white light. The light will stop flashing and change to a solid white light if the unit has been set up, or to a flashing green light if it has not.

If you have a new Sub unit that does not show a flashing white light immediately after plugging it into power, please try another power socket to be sure there isn’t a problem with the first. If that does not help, I recommend you get in touch with our technical support team who will send you a new power cable in the first instance and replace the Sub in the second (if the new power cable does not help).
